I. Organizational structure
Take the mine leaders as the overall responsibility, set up a fire-fighting emergency evacuation organization, which consists of fire-fighting action group, evacuation guidance group, warning group, power supply (water) group, medical rescue group, communication liaison group, fire-fighting support group and expert group. The specific division of labor is as follows:
1. Fire fighting action group: the operation team leader is the team leader, leading part-time firefighters and fire engines to put out the fire and assisting warehouse managers to rescue the property not surrounded by the fire;
2. Communication liaison group: led by the deputy director of the office, responsible for issuing an alarm through ground broadcasting and directing employees to evacuate the area threatened by fire calmly, orderly and quickly;
3. Evacuation guidance group: the director of the security command center is the group leader, and the security personnel are responsible for the evacuation of people in the area and on the road;
4. Safety protection and rescue team: the director of the dispatching room is the team leader, responsible for logistics support such as vehicles and medical rescue in case of fire;
5. Alert group: the security chief is the group leader, responsible for pulling up warning tape at the fire site to prevent irrelevant personnel from entering the fire area;
6. Power supply group: the person in charge of the electromechanical department is the group leader, who is responsible for controlling the on-site power supply and ensuring the standby power supply;
7. Fire protection group: headed by the head of the business administration department, responsible for deploying fire-fighting materials for fire fighting and contacting the general headquarters to do a good job of protection;
8. Medical rescue team: the director of the office serves as the team leader, and the director of the infirmary serves as the deputy team leader, responsible for mobilizing medical personnel, preparing various medical devices for first aid and ambulance, and arranging emergency vehicles.
9. Expert group: the deputy mine manager of safety is the team leader, and the deputy mine managers of all disciplines are the deputy team leaders. Members of safety department, production department, electromechanical department, dispatching room, office and infirmary are assigned to organize fire assessment and treatment measures to provide technical support for the fire fighting decision of the headquarters.
Second, the alarm and alarm procedures
1. The alarm monitoring center must be equipped with a fire alarm telephone, and the personnel on duty should stick to their posts and monitor the key parts of the enterprise 24 hours a day.
2. After receiving the fire alarm signal and fire alarm call in the monitoring area, the monitoring center shall immediately notify the personnel on duty and patrol officers to rush to the scene with walkie-talkies and call the leaders on duty.
3. The duty room must be equipped with necessary disaster relief facilities. After the personnel on duty arrive at the scene, if there is no fire, they should find out the alarm reason of the alarm signal and make detailed records.
4. In case of fire, immediately call "1 19" to report to the fire brigade according to the fire, and feed back the information to the monitoring alarm center, and carry out fire fighting and evacuation work at the same time.
5, monitoring center according to the fire situation, mobilize relevant personnel to start the fire fighting and emergency plan.
Three. Organizational procedures and measures for emergency evacuation
1, in order to make the fire fighting and emergency evacuation plan go smoothly, the security department should strengthen daily inspections to ensure the smooth flow of fire exits.
2, public * * * gathering places (places where people are relatively concentrated) should keep the fire exits unblocked, the entrances and exits are clearly marked, the fire exits and emergency doors cannot be locked, and the evacuation route has obvious guidance legends.
3, when the fire broke out, the evacuation guide personnel should quickly rushed to the fire, using emergency broadcast to command the crowd to evacuate in an organized way.
4. The evacuation route should be as simple as possible and arranged nearby, and evacuation instructions should be set in the aisle.
5, evacuation guidance group personnel to clear division of labor, unified command.
Four, general primary fire extinguishing procedures and measures
1, when a fire breaks out, keep calm and take appropriate measures to organize fire fighting and evacuation.
2. For the fire that can be put out immediately, we should seize the fighter plane and destroy it quickly.
3. For the fire that can't be put out immediately, we must first control the spread of the fire, and then carry out comprehensive fighting.
4, fire fighting should obey the unified command of temporary fire commander, a clear division of labor, close cooperation.
5. When the firemen arrive, the temporary commander shall report the situation of the fire scene to the firemen, obey the unified command of the firemen, and cooperate with the fire brigade for fire fighting and evacuation.
6. After the fire fighting is completed, the security department should actively assist the public security fire department to investigate the cause of the fire, implement the principle of "four don't let go" and deal with the fire accident.
V. Procedures and measures for communication, safety protection and rescue
1. All personnel involved in fire fighting and emergency evacuation should turn on communication tools to ensure smooth communication and obey the command of the communication liaison team leader.
2, disaster relief team members should be on standby at the fire.
3, the infirmary staff on the scene in a timely manner to treat the injured in the fire, if necessary, contact the local hospital for treatment.
4. Vehicles should be mobilized to ensure smooth traffic.
5. Designate a special person to register and keep the materials that have been rescued and transferred, and coordinate relevant departments to clean up and register the fire losses.

Emergency Plan for Coal Mine Safety Production 2 1 General Provisions
The purpose of compiling 1. 1
In order to further enhance the ability of coal mine safety production to prevent accident risks and respond to accidents quickly and efficiently, and minimize casualties and property losses caused by accidents, this plan is formulated.
1.2 compilation basis
Law on Safety in Production, Mine Safety Law, Emergency Response Law, Regulations on Reporting, Investigation and Handling of Production Safety Accidents, Measures for the Administration of Emergency Plans for Production Safety Accidents, Regulations on Coal Mine Safety, Measures for the Administration of Emergency Plans for Emergencies in Shanxi Province, Emergency Plans for Coal Mines in Shanxi Province, Overall Emergency Plans for Public Emergencies in Changzhi City, and Emergency Plans for Production Safety Accidents in Changzhi City, etc.
1.3 working principle
(1) People-oriented, safety first. Coal mine accident emergency rescue work should always put the protection of people's life safety and health in the first place, effectively strengthen the safety protection of emergency rescue personnel, and minimize the casualties and harm caused by coal mine accidents.
(2) Unified leadership and hierarchical management. Under the unified leadership of the Municipal Party Committee and the Municipal Government, the Municipal Coal Bureau is responsible for guiding and coordinating the rescue work of coal mine accidents in the city. County-level coal management departments shall, in accordance with their respective responsibilities and authorities, do a good job in emergency handling of accidents under the command and coordination of the local people's government and the Municipal Bureau; Coal mining enterprises should conscientiously fulfill the main responsibility of production safety and establish emergency plans and emergency mechanisms for production safety.
(3) The combination of regions is mainly territorial. Coal mine accident emergency rescue work by the local government and departments unified command, guidance and coordination of higher authorities. Relevant departments perform their duties according to law, experts provide technical support, and enterprises give full play to their self-help role.
(4) Relying on science and standardizing according to law. Improve the equipment, facilities and means of emergency rescue, standardize emergency rescue work according to law, and ensure the scientificity, authority and operability of the plan.
(5) Prevention first, combining peacetime with wartime. Carry out the policy of "safety first, prevention first and comprehensive treatment" and adhere to the combination of prevention and accident emergency. In accordance with the requirements of long-term preparation and key construction, do a good job in ideological preparation, plan preparation, material preparation and fund preparation for coal mine accidents. Strengthen training exercises and always be vigilant.
1.4 preplan system
The emergency plan system for production safety accidents in Changzhi coal mine consists of the emergency plan for production safety accidents in Changzhi coal mine, the emergency plan for production safety accidents in county coal mines and the emergency plan for production safety accidents in coal mining enterprises. This plan is connected with the emergency plan for coal mine accidents in Shanxi Province and the emergency plan for production safety accidents in Changzhi City.
1.5 Scope of application
This plan is applicable to the following coal mine accident emergency disposal work:
(1) General accidents in coal mines directly under the municipal supervision;
(2) Extraordinary and major coal mine accidents;
(3) major coal mine accidents across counties and cities;
(4) Coal mine accidents in which emergency rescue forces and resources in counties and cities are insufficient and need reinforcements;
(5) the leading comrades of the municipal party committee and the municipal government have important instructions and have great social impact on coal mine accidents;
(6) Coal mine accidents that the Municipal Coal Bureau considers necessary to start this plan.

3 Early warning and prevention mechanism
3. 1 Information monitoring and reporting
City and county departments in charge of coal and coal mining enterprises should, according to the types and characteristics of natural disasters and accidents in coal mines, establish and improve the basic information database, improve the monitoring network, divide the monitoring areas, determine the monitoring points, define the monitoring items, equip them with necessary equipment and facilities, and equip them with full-time or part-time personnel to monitor possible coal mine accidents and disasters.
(1) The Municipal Coal Bureau is responsible for receiving, reporting, preliminary processing, statistical analysis of major and extraordinarily serious accidents of coal mining enterprises in the city and general accidents of coal mines directly under the municipal supervision, and formulating relevant work systems.
(2) The Municipal Coal Bureau shall focus on monitoring the major hazard sources existing in the municipal supervision coal mines, timely analyze the key monitoring information, and track the rectification.
(III) The coal management departments of counties and urban areas shall establish a database of basic information and major hazard sources of coal mines within their respective jurisdictions, implement key monitoring and subsequent rectification, and report the major hazard sources to the Municipal Coal Bureau.
(four) coal mining enterprises shall, according to the geological conditions, the types of disasters that may occur and the degree of harm, establish a database of their basic information and hazard sources, and report it to the local coal management department for the record.
3.2 Early warning and preventive actions
3.2. 1 Early warning and prevention work in coal industry
City and county coal departments should regularly analyze and study the information that may cause safety accidents, and study and determine the response plan; Timely notify relevant units to take targeted measures to prevent accidents. After the accident, start the emergency plan and organize rescue according to the accident situation. When necessary, request the superior department to coordinate reinforcements. Large (Grade II) coal mine safety production accidents and general accidents directly under the coal mine shall be dispatched by the Information Dispatching Center of the Municipal Coal Bureau, so as to understand the development of the situation and report it in time, and notify the heads of the member units of the leading group at the first time. At the same time, according to the instructions, timely notify the relevant mine emergency rescue teams, rescue experts and rescue technical support institutions to make emergency preparations.
3.2.2 Early warning and prevention work of coal mining enterprises
(1) Strengthen the management of major hazard sources, conduct regular investigation and management of potential safety hazards, and eliminate potential safety hazards in time; Conscientiously implement the provisions of the enterprise safety risk plan, regularly organize safety production risk analysis, and effectively use the safety production monitoring system for real-time dynamic early warning and forecasting.
(2) When major hazard sources are out of control or major safety hazards show signs of accidents, immediately release and transmit early warning information, and report to superiors according to procedures; Issue early warning instructions, start early warning action plans, stop production, organize personnel evacuation, and implement corresponding preventive measures; Strengthen monitoring, closely follow the development of the situation, check the implementation of measures, and make corresponding emergency preparations; Once an accident happens, start the corresponding emergency response and deal with it in time according to the emergency plan and on-site disposal plan.
(3) On-site foremen, team leaders and dispatchers have the right to give orders to stop production and withdraw people at the first time in case of danger, control personnel to enter or close, and restrict the use of dangerous places.
4 emergency response
4. 1 information report
(1) After an accident occurs in a coal mining enterprise, the relevant personnel at the scene of the accident shall immediately report to the person in charge of the unit. After receiving the report, the person in charge of the coal mining enterprise shall report to the city and county coal and safety supervision departments and the municipal coal supervision branch within 1 hour.
In case of emergency, the relevant personnel at the scene of the accident can report directly to the coal department.
(2) After receiving the accident report, the county coal department should report to the Municipal Coal Bureau, Changzhi Coal Supervision Branch and the provincial coal department step by step within 1 hour.
(3) After receiving the coal mine accident report, the Municipal Coal Bureau immediately reported to the Municipal Party Committee and the Provincial Coal Department.
If there is any new situation after the accident report, it should be reported in time.
(4) Report content: general situation of the accident unit; The time, place and scene of the accident; A brief description of the accident; The number of casualties caused or likely to be caused by the accident (including the number of people unaccounted for) and the preliminary estimated direct economic losses; Measures already taken; Other circumstances that should be reported.
4.2 Hierarchical Response Procedure
4.2. 1 first-order response
After receiving the report of major accidents or possible accidents, the coal bureaus of cities and counties immediately started the level I response, coordinated the relevant departments, relevant units and mine professional emergency rescue teams to do a good job in pre-disposal, controlled the development of the situation, and prevented the occurrence of secondary and derivative accidents. When the superior starts the emergency response and takes over the command, the municipal and county coal bureaus shall coordinate the emergency response under the unified leadership of the superior.
4.2.2 Secondary emergency response
After receiving a report of a major accident or a possible major accident, the city and county coal bureaus shall immediately start the level II response and promptly notify all members of the emergency leading group to rush to the scene of the accident to carry out emergency rescue. County Coal Bureau shall do a good job in pre-disposal according to the plan at the corresponding level, and cooperate with the municipal headquarters to do a good job in emergency rescue. When the situation changes and the emergency force is insufficient, the municipal headquarters shall promptly request the superior to coordinate the relevant forces to reinforce.
4.2.3 Three-level emergency response
County Coal Bureau received a general or possible general accident report (Municipal Coal Bureau received a general accident report of coal mines directly under the supervision of the municipal government), and should immediately start Class III emergency response according to the plan at the corresponding level, rush to the scene of the accident and carry out emergency rescue. Emergency headquarters paid close attention to the development of the situation, strengthened information communication, transmission and feedback, informed relevant departments and units to prepare for rescue at any time, and sent personnel to the scene of the accident to supervise the rescue work. Emergency headquarters, the coal mine where the accident occurred and the county where the accident occurred shall coordinate relevant forces to do a good job in emergency response as required. When the emergency force is insufficient, it should promptly request the municipal headquarters to coordinate the relevant forces to reinforce.
4.3 Command and coordination and emergency response
(1) After a coal mine accident, the accident unit shall report it in time in accordance with the relevant regulations, and organize employees to carry out self-help and mutual rescue on the premise of ensuring safety according to the emergency plan and on-site disposal plan at the corresponding level, and notify or request relevant professional rescue agencies and teams for reinforcements according to the accident situation and emergency rescue needs.
(2) After receiving the report, the coal management department and the main enterprise of the coal mine shall report it in a timely manner in accordance with the relevant regulations, and immediately start the corresponding emergency response, and organize forces to carry out the preliminary emergency disposal work in accordance with the emergency plan at the corresponding level.
(3) According to the emergency response level of the accident, the upper and lower emergency command institutions are connected to jointly establish the on-site emergency rescue headquarters. Command and coordination matters:
(1) According to the emergency rescue work, report the progress of emergency rescue to the superior in time, and put forward suggestions on major emergency rescue matters;
(2) Seriously implement the decision instructions of the on-site headquarters, formulate or revise scientific rescue plans in time, and implement emergency rescue;
(3) to coordinate the implementation of the team, materials, funds, transportation, medical care, communications, electricity, natural disaster information, social mobilization, technical support and other security measures;
(4) Organizing public security alert;
⑤ Make good news reports.
(4) Under the unified command and coordination of the on-site headquarters, the teams and personnel involved in emergency rescue actively carry out emergency rescue operations and various safeguard actions according to the deployment and scheme of emergency rescue work. Action content:
① Organize rescue and treatment of victims;
(2) Quickly discover and control or eliminate hidden dangers of accidents, mark or delimit dangerous areas to prevent accidents from expanding;
(3) According to the accident type, quickly restore the damaged power supply, ventilation, transportation, drainage, communication and other systems, and take measures to create conditions for people in distress to escape;
(4) Organize professionals to strengthen the monitoring of the environment and gas in the disaster area to ensure the smooth rescue work;
⑤ Actively organize all kinds of emergency support.
(5) According to the development and changes of the situation, when the special danger deteriorates sharply, the on-site command will take emergency measures in time according to law on the basis of fully considering the opinions of experts and relevant parties.
(6) In the process of emergency rescue, if continuing the emergency rescue has a direct threat to the lives of rescuers, which may lead to secondary accidents, or the rescue conditions are not available, or it is worthless to continue the emergency rescue, after full argumentation by rescue experts, the opinions on suspending the emergency rescue shall be decided by the on-site command and the Municipal People's Government with great influence.
4.4 Safety protection of rescuers
In the process of emergency rescue and disaster relief, professional or auxiliary rescuers should take corresponding safety protection measures according to the types and nature of coal mine accidents. The rescue of coal mine accidents must be carried out by professional coal mine rescue teams, and the number of people entering the scene of the accident should be strictly controlled. All emergency rescue personnel must wear safety protection equipment before entering the accident rescue area to carry out emergency rescue work. Each emergency rescue operation site should arrange special personnel to detect the composition, wind direction and temperature of underground air and harmful gases to ensure the safety of the operation site.
4.5 information release
The Municipal Coal Bureau cooperates with the municipal government to release information on major coal mine accidents. County-level coal departments shall cooperate with the county-level government to release general coal mine accident information, and the release of production safety accident information shall be accurate, objective, correctly guide public opinion and maintain social stability.
4.6 the end of the state of emergency
After the scene of the accident is controlled, the environment meets the relevant standards, and the hidden dangers of secondary and derivative accidents are eliminated, the on-site emergency disposal work is completed and the emergency rescue team is evacuated after confirmation and approval by the on-site emergency rescue headquarters. After the completion of the aftermath of the coal mine accident, the on-site emergency rescue headquarters organized the completion of the emergency rescue summary report, which was reported to the city and county coal bureaus and the local government, and the government announced the end of the emergency treatment.
5 Post-treatment
5. 1 aftermath
After the emergency rescue work, the people's governments of counties and cities, major mining enterprises and coal mines are responsible for organizing the aftermath. After the emergency rescue work, the departments and units involved in the rescue carefully counted the number of people participating in the emergency rescue and counted the rescue equipment and equipment; Accounting for disaster relief expenses, sorting out emergency rescue records and drawings, and writing rescue reports.
Coal mining enterprises should draw lessons from accidents, strengthen safety management, increase investment in safety, earnestly implement the responsibility for safety production, and formulate safety measures during the resumption of production to prevent accidents.
5.2 Insurance
After the accident, timely coordinate the insurance institutions to send personnel to carry out relevant insurance acceptance and claim settlement work.
5.3 Work Summary and Evaluation
After the emergency response, the competent coal authorities and coal mining enterprises should carefully analyze the cause of the accident, formulate preventive measures, implement the responsibility system for safe production, and prevent similar accidents.
County-level coal departments or emergency rescue headquarters are responsible for collecting and sorting out emergency rescue records, plans, documents and other materials, organizing experts to summarize and evaluate the emergency rescue process and emergency rescue support, putting forward rectification opinions and suggestions, and reporting the summary and evaluation report to the Municipal Coal Bureau within 1 month after the end of emergency response.

Rescue team support
(1) There are 7 full-time mine rescue teams in Changzhi City, namely: City Mine Rescue Team, Lu 'an Group Rescue Team, Zhaozhuang Squadron of Jinmei Group Rescue Fire Center, Qinyuan County Mine Rescue Squadron, Changzhi County Mine Rescue Squadron, Xiangyuan County Mine Rescue Team and Shanxi Sanyuan Coal Mine Rescue Squadron.
(2) Changzhi City has a part-time mine rescue team to supervise all coal production enterprises.

7 Supplementary clauses
7. 1 response grading standard
According to the controllability, severity and influence scope of accidents and disasters, the emergency response levels of coal mine accidents are divided into Grade I (major and particularly major accidents), Grade II (major accidents) and Grade III (general accidents). (General accidents, major accidents, major and above accidents are classified according to the regulations of the State Council).
